We are looking for a Senior Product Systems Architect to shape the architecture and system-level definition of a digital monitoring platform for substations.
This is a product-facing technical leadership role at the intersection of customer needs, product strategy, system architecture and engineering execution. The successful candidate will translate customer problems into technically feasible and commercially sensible system solutions, while coordinating internal engineering teams, suppliers and technology partners.
Roles and Responsibilities:
Define and own the overall architecture of the substation monitoring platform, encompassing hardware, firmware, software, and data layers.
Translate customer and product needs into system capabilities, requirements, interfaces and technical acceptance criteria, ensuring alignment with product goals and operational constraints.
Act as the technical bridge between product management, domain SME, engineering teams, suppliers and customers.
Create and maintain the key architecture, system requirements and interface documentation needed to guide engineering.
Lead technical product discovery, feasibility assessments, prototypes and architecture trade-offs across performance, cost, scalability, reliability, and maintainability.
Develop a forward-looking platform strategy to support integration of AI/analytics, expandability, and evolving grid needs.
Design software architecture to support edge-to-cloud integration, including secure communication, scalable data pipelines, and deployment flexibility
Design the software and data architecture for secure edge-to-cloud integration, scalable data pipelines, and flexible deployment across local, distributed, and cloud environments.
Align system design with industry standards (e.g., IEC 61850, IEEE C37, DNP3, MODBUS) for secure and reliable operation in grid environments.
Integrate sensor data, asset models, and diagnostic tools into a unified platform covering data acquisition, processing, visualization, and diagnostics..
Establish architectural patterns for modular deployment, secure access control, update mechanisms, and multi-tenant operation for cloud systems.
Manage technical decisions around containerization (e.g., Docker), orchestration (e.g., Kubernetes), and cloud services (e.g., AWS, Azure).
Support field trials and customer pilots, incorporating lessons learned into the product architecture.
Support make–buy–partner decisions and lead the technical evaluation and integration of suppliers, sensors, analytics providers and third-party technologies,

What We Do
GE Vernova is a planned purpose-built company on a mission to electrify the planet while simultaneously working to decarbonize it. If we want our energy future to be different…we must be different. Our mission is embedded in our name. We retain our treasured legacy, “GE,” in our name as an enduring and hard-earned badge of quality and ingenuity. “Ver” / “verde” signal Earth’s verdant and lush ecosystems. “Nova,” from the Latin “novus,” nods to a new, innovative era of lower carbon energy that GE Vernova will help deliver. GE Vernova brings together GE’s portfolio of energy businesses including Power, Wind, Electrification and Digital businesses.
